Introduction to Michael Burry’s Investment Philosophy
Michael Burry’s investment approach is characterized by his value investing strategy, which involves identifying undervalued companies with strong financials and growth potential. He is known for his meticulous research and analysis, often taking contrarian positions that go against the market consensus. Burry’s investment philosophy is centered around the idea of finding value in unexpected places, which has led him to invest in a range of sectors, from technology and healthcare to finance and real estate.
